Company profile: Ramp
1.1 - Company Overview
Company description
- Provider of digital advertising solutions for retail networks, offering a platform to manage local campaigns with centralized or decentralized activation and reporting; Trade Ads to automate media budget allocation by point of sale based on sales data and other criteria; drive-to-store marketing via geolocated ads and promotions; and BELIEVE for digital artist promotion across YouTube, Spotify, and TikTok in over 50 countries.
Products and services
- Drive-to-Store Marketing: Geolocation-based strategy combining digital marketing initiatives with in-store experiences, deploying geolocated ads and promotions to increase physical store traffic at participating retail locations
- The Ramp Platform: Enterprise-grade platform engineered to manage local digital advertising campaigns for retail networks, offering centralized and decentralized modes for campaign activation and reporting
- Trade Ads: Data-driven service that automates dynamic media budget allocation per point of sale, using sales data and other criteria to optimize spend distribution across retail locations
